Motorcycle Accident Claims

Motorcyclists who have been in an accident with a motorbike could be eligible for compensation. You may pursue a claim against the person at fault, either through insurance or a personal injury lawsuit.

You must show that the defendant failed to meet their duty of care, and that your injuries resulted from this breach when you seek compensation.

Medical bills

Medical expenses can quickly add in the aftermath of a motorbike accident, particularly if you are suffering from severe injuries. This includes treatment for broken bones as well as lacerations, plastic surgeries and traumatic brain injuries. These types of damages could easily be more than six figures.

There are many ways that you can avoid this financial burden. First, you should be aware of the laws of your state regarding motorcycle insurance and the options for coverage.

In some states, motorcyclists can be allowed to purchase special personal injury protection (PIP) insurance. This insurance can help you cover medical expenses when you're involved in an accident caused by a negligent driver.

However, you shouldn't assume that the PIP insurance you purchased will automatically cover all of your medical expenses. In many cases, it will cover the limits stipulated by your policy. Your employer might be able to reimburse you for any additional insurance or coverage you may have through a work-related plan.

Your health insurance plan may cover the cost of X-rays and other tests to determine the extent and severity of your injuries. Prescription medications and hospitalization after an accident with a motorcycle could be covered by your health insurance.

If you're unable to pay for these medical expenses, your doctor might be willing to file a lien against the funds you receive from your insurance company. This is referred to as subrogation. It is a way to make sure that you do not get paid twice for the same medical expenses.

It is important to consult a qualified attorney immediately after an accident to avoid getting into financial trouble. They will be able to navigate through this difficult issue and help you get the compensation you are entitled to for your injuries.

You won't be able to have any of your medical bills paid by an at-fault motorist's auto insurance policy until you have filed an insurance claim under their bodily injury liability (BIL) coverage. BIL coverage is the minimum amount of insurance that motorists need to carry in Florida.

Loss of wages

A motorbike accident can be a huge disruption to your personal and professional life. It can cause you to be unable to work and miss out on an income that you need to live. It could also take you away from your family and home.

If you're unable work and are unable to keep up with the expenses you should be compensated for the loss of wages. Based on the extent of your injuries, you could be eligible to recover damages for past wages and future lost wages that you will be unable to earn.

In addition to lost wages, you may also be entitled to compensation for the damage to your property as well as pain and suffering. A lawyer will assess your losses and convert them into monetary amounts.

For instance, if were injured in an accident and are now unable to work, your lawyer will calculate the amount of your lost income. This includes your lost pay stubs, the amount of benefits you had before the accident, as well as other evidence that can be used to support your claim for lost wages.

You may also want to look at any medical bills that you may be liable for due to the accident. Keep track of your doctor’s notes which exempt you from work. This can aid your lawyer in constructing an argument that is strong for lost wages and other damages related to the accident.

Your lawyer should also include in your lost income calculations the value of any benefits you may have received before the accident, such as health insurance, disability insurance and retirement benefits. These benefits are expensive, and they can cost you a lot of dollars in the long run.

Another important aspect of the loss of income is how much it will take to return to where you were prior to the crash. It's a challenge to figure this out because it requires the calculation of the future earnings you will earn. Your lawyer will use complex formulas to determine your income and age.
